    The klingons went to war with the Federation begining at Season 4 with "Way of the Warrior" (The 1st appearance of Worf on DS9) due to thier protection of the Cardasian Rulling Council. The klingon's beleved that they had been replaced by changlings.

    When Gowron dissolved the Khitomer Accords he also demanded the return of the Acturus (Is this correct?) Sector which had been ceded to the Federation.

    The war was ended Partialy due to Sisko & crew exposing Gen. Martok as a changling at the begining of Season 5 and ended when the real Martok was found By Worf and Cardasia joined the Dominion in Mid-Season "In Purgatory's Shadow". Martok was stationed by Gowron on DS9 to command a contingent of Klingon Warriors operating out of the station for it's defence and to be on the front line of any Dominion conflict.

    The war begins at the start of 2372 and lasts until mid 2373.

    Following the 'Way of the Warrior', the war is mentioned in the following episodes:

    'Hippocratic Oath' Klingons make attacks on Romulan outposts.

    'For the Cause' Klingons continue attcks on Cardassian outposts. The maquis uses the oportunity to increase operations.

    'Return to Grace' Klingons destroy an outpost on Korma, killing Bajoran and Cardassian delegates at a conference. Dukat captures a bird of prey and begins a campaign against the Klingons.

    'Sons of Mogh' The Klingons attempt to mine the Bajoran system.

    'Rules of Engagement' Cardassians request Starfleet protection for a releif convoy to Pentath. During Klingon attacks Worf destroys a Klingon transport. It is, of course, a Klingon plot to end Federation protection of the convoys.

    'Broken Link' The Federation Council calls on the Klingons to relinquish Cardassian territory. Gowron re-estblishes Klingon claims to the Archanis sector.

    'Apocalypse Rising' The USS Drake and USS Armstrong are ambushed by a Klingon battlegroup. Sisko and crew unmask the Martok changeling. Gowron grees to a cease-fire.

    'Nor the Battle to the Strong' The Klingos attack Ajilon Prime in the Archais sector. The USS Farragut is destroyed en-route to Ajilon. The USS Rutledge and USS Tecumseh lead the Federation counterattack in the Archanis sector.

    'In Purgatory's Shadow' and 'By Inferno's Light' Martok is rescued. The Cardassian Union joins the Dominion. In light of the new threat, Gowron re-established the Khitomer accords.

    In the midst of this this there is the attempted coup by Admiral Leyton as well.
